Hello, and welcome aboard. This Friday we are running a disaster-recovery drill for Fabrikit, our test-data factory library. During the drill, the primary fixture registry will be taken offline and restored from backup. As a contractor, you only need to restore your local mirror afterward. The restore tool will prompt for the recovery passphrase, provided below.

unlock words, hahip-yagef: zorok-novmir-zorix-silax

Subject: Largefile diff viewer cut-over complete

Hello plugin authors — the Splayview diff engine cut-over finished last night without rollback. Files above the chunking threshold now stream through the new tiler, so plugins must not assume the full buffer is resident. Hooks fire per chunk; ordering is preserved. Please retest against staging this week. The engine now runs with the following configuration.

deployment values, bafog-tajop:
NOVAEL_PIN=7103
NOVAEL_TENANT=weneth
NOVAEL_METRICS_HOST=metrics.novael.crelvocorp.corp
NOVAEL_SEAL=seal_be72a3d3
NOVAEL_STANDBY_TEAM=caseth

This constant caps traversal depth when expanding transitive edges;
// raising it beyond 12 has historically caused the renderer to stall on the
// billing cluster's cyclic vendored packages. If you're on call and the
// visualizer page hangs, check the edge-expansion worker logs before touching
// this value. Any change must be paired with a cache flush, or stale layouts
// will persist for hours. The build that last validated this limit is recorded
// directly below.

session token of kageg-tahop = htk14_af3c1ccccb7dcf